入排标准
入选标准
- •1. Informed consent;
- •2. >18 years of age;
- •3. Adequate birth control (if not post-menopausal or sterilised) during a 2 week pre- and 6 week post-op period if assigned to vitreoretinal surgery;
- •4. Subjective decrease in visual acuity starting within 4 weeks prior to study start, due to CRVO, clinically evident by fundoscopy;
- •5. Non-perfused or perfused CRVO with a visual acuity of less than 20/200.
- •Note : Pseudophakic patients are allowed to participate in this study.
排除标准
- •1. Inability to visualize fundus due to corneal or important lenticular opacities;
- •2. Inability to obtain photographs of CRVO due to allergy to fluorescein or lack of veinous access;
- •3. As visual acuity prognosis is better and risk for neovascularisation is reduced in perfused CRVO, patients with a visual acuity > 20/200 will not be included;
- •4. Presence of iris neovascularisation (> grade 1) or anterior chamber angle (>grade 1) at the moment of presentation;
- •5. Other retinal or ophthalmic disorders that could influence the macular area;
- •6. Disorders that could be complicated by iris or retinal neovascularisation;
- •7. Disorders that could be complicated by any form of secondary glaucoma;
- •8. Prescription of acetazolamide or high dose systemic steroid (> 10 mg prednisone daily) or other anti-inflammatory medication (eg. MTX, Imuran, Endoxan, Humira, Kineret, Infliximab, Thalidomide) except NSAIDs;
- •9. Participation in another clinical ophthalmic trial;
- •10. Any surgery of the orbit, ocular adnexae or eye scheduled during the period the study (except for cataract surgery, developed after inclusion to a degree as outlined by the protocol);
- •11. Monophthalmia or other known ophthalmic disorder in the fellow eye that could be complicated by blindness;
- •12. Previous retinal surgery;
- •13. High myopia (-8 D spherical equivalent or more);
- •14. Macula affecting drugs.
